Perennial Advisors LLC acquired a new position in shares of Novartis AG (NYSE:NVS - Free Report) in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m acquired 41,171 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$4,006,000.
Several other hedge funds also recently modified their holdings of the company. Vermillion Wealth Management Inc. bought a new position in Novartis in the fourth quarter valued at approximately $45,000. Forum Financial Management LP boosted its stake in Novartis by 3.1% in the fourth quarter. Forum Financial Management LP now owns 24,553 shares of the company's stock valued at $2,389,000 after acquiring an additional 731 shares during the last quarter. Michels Family Financial LLC bought a new position in Novartis in the fourth quarter valued at approximately $339,000. Castlekeep Investment Advisors LLC bought a new position in Novartis in the fourth quarter valued at approximately $1,128,000. Finally, Parr Mcknight Wealth Management Group LLC bought a new position in Novartis in the fourth quarter valued at approximately $2,018,000. Institutional investors and hedge funds own 13.12% of the company's stock.

Novartis (NYSE:NVS -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, April 29th. The company reported $2.28 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$2.12 by $0.16. The company had revenue of $13.23 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$12.92 billion. Novartis had a net margin of 23.56% and a return on equity of 37.24%. Novartis's revenue for the quarter was up 11.9%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the previous year, the business earned $1.80 EPS. As a group, equities research analysts predict that Novartis AG will post 8.45 EPS for the current year.
Novartis Company Profile
(
Free Report)
Novartis AG engages in the research, development, manufacture, and marketing of healthcare products in Switzerland and internationally. The company offers prescription medicines for patients and physicians. It focuses on therapeutic areas, such as cardiovascular, renal and metabolic, immunology, neuroscience, and oncology, as well as ophthalmology and hematology.
